Getting There

  • Walking

    If you're starting from the historic center of Córdoba, head towards the Plaza de las Tendillas. From there, take Calle Cruz Conde towards the Plaza de la Corredera. Continue straight until you reach the intersection with Calle José Cruz. Turn left onto Calle José Cruz, and then take another left onto Calle Alfaros. Walk straight until you reach Plaza del Conde de Priego. The Monumento a Manolete will be located at number 1 on this square.

  • Bus

    From the Córdoba Bus Station, take Bus Line 3 towards the city center. Get off at the stop 'Plaza de las Tendillas'. From here, walk towards Calle Cruz Conde, and follow the walking directions provided above to reach Plaza del Conde de Priego where the Monumento a Manolete is located.

  • Bicycle

    If you have rented a bicycle, start from the Avenida de la Libertad and head towards the city center. Follow the bike lane along Calle Gran Capitán until you reach Plaza de las Tendillas. From there, continue with the walking directions: head down Calle Cruz Conde, turn left onto Calle José Cruz, then left onto Calle Alfaros until you arrive at Plaza del Conde de Priego.

  • Taxi

    If you prefer to take a taxi, simply tell the driver to take you to 'Plaza del Conde de Priego.' The ride from the main tourist areas in Córdoba should be quick and cost-effective, allowing you to arrive directly at the Monumento a Manolete.

The Monumento a Manolete is an iconic landmark located in the lively city of Córdoba, Spain, dedicated to the legendary bullfighter Manuel Rodríguez Sánchez, known as Manolete. This impressive monument, crafted with meticulous detail, captures the essence of the bullfighting tradition that has historically been a significant aspect of Spanish culture. Standing majestically in Plaza del Conde de Priego, it attracts both locals and tourists alike, serving as a focal point for those eager to delve into the city's rich history. Visitors to the monument will find themselves in a vibrant square adorned with beautiful trees and benches, making it an ideal spot for relaxation and contemplation. The monument itself is not only a tribute to Manolete's legacy but also a piece of art that reflects the intricate craftsmanship typical of the era.
